How much do woman millwright j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for woman millwright in the United States is $28.28,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$24.28 and $31.73 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Both Woman Millwrights and Woman Pipefitters work in industrial environments, often requiring similar safety certifications and apprenticeships. Millwrights focus on installing and maintaining machinery, while Pipefitters specialize in installing piping systems. Their roles often overlap in construction and industrial settings, but each has distinct technical skills and certifications.

Position Overview
We are seeking a Millwright Project Manager to lead industrial equipment projects from concept through completion while building strong, solutions-driven client relationships. This role combines technical expertise with project management and business development responsibilities. The ideal candidate brings hands-on millwright knowledge, a strong customer orientation, and the ability to manage multiple projects while driving new and existing business growth across a wide-variety of industries. Key responsibilities include:
  • Build and maintain strong, solutions-oriented relationships with new and existing customers.
  • Serve as a primary point of contact for client accounts, identifying opportunities to expand services and grow business.
  • Develop, prepare, and present estimates and proposals using industry knowledge and internal processes.
  • Manage multiple projects simultaneously, ensuring alignment with scope, schedule, budget, and quality expectations.
  • Coordinate with internal teams to communicate project requirements, timelines, and customer needs.
  • Monitor project performance, including financials, resource allocation, and delivery outcomes.
  • Provide regular updates and reporting on current projects and future sales opportunities.
  • Ensure customer satisfaction by delivering high-quality results that meet or exceed expectations.
  • Support contract review and documentation, including AIA-related materials as applicable.

Requirements
Qualifications
  • Proven experience with industrial or production facility equipment, including installation, repair, modification, and relocation.
  • Demonstrated success managing industrial projects, including financial, timeline, and resource management.
  • Strong customer-facing skills with the ability to build relationships, network, and communicate effectively.
  • Experience with project estimation and a solid understanding of sales processes.
  • Ability to collaborate cross-functionally and drive a team-based approach to project execution.
  • Proficiency with software tools for CRM, estimating, project financial management, and project close-out.
  • Working knowledge of contract review processes; AIA document experience preferred.
  •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ering, Construction Management, Business, or related field preferred but not required.
  • Minimum of three (3) years of relevant experience.
  • PMP, PgMP, CAPM, or similar project management certification preferred.
